    The CEO of Confidence Group briefed representatives of international companies on stricter requirements for installation work visas and the new regulations for their extension in 2026

    On February 11, Andrei Sprintchan, General Director of Confidence Group, took part in a meeting of the Migration Committee of the American Chamber of Commerce (AmCham/TEDA) in Moscow. The event focused on current changes in migration legislation and the practical challenges employers face when hiring foreign specialists.

    The first part of the meeting was dedicated to forecasts regarding the tightening of migration policies and changes in the procedure for hiring foreign labor: trends in rulemaking for 2026, what to expect, and how to prepare.

    During the second part of the meeting, which covered practical aspects, Andrei Sprintchan delivered a presentation titled: "Visas for Installation Work: Stricter Requirements for the Document Package, Medical Examination, and Fingerprinting. New Regulations for Extending This Type of Visa within Russia."

    In his speech, he thoroughly analyzed the key changes that occurred in 2026 in the procedure for obtaining visas for installation and supervisory installation work.

    The audience was presented with:

    • Upd ated requirements for the se t of documents: special attention was given to the wording in the equipment supply contract, confirmation of employee qualifications, and documents related to the equipment, including the customs declaration.
    • Mandatory procedures: Andrei Sprintchan reminded attendees about the necessity of undergoing a medical examination and fingerprint registration for specialists planning to stay in Russia for more than 30 days, and also explained the risks and fines for non-compliance with these requirements.
    • New extension regulations: particular attention was paid to the procedure for extending installation visas within Russia, which remains a complex issue due to the lack of clear regulations, requiring companies to be especially diligent when planning work schedules.

    Participation in the event allowed representatives of international companies to receive up-to-date information first-hand, analyze complex cases, and ask experts questions about interacting with the Ministry of Internal Affairs under the current circumstances.
